What is Hyaluronic Acid?
Hyaluronic acid is a polymeric organic molecule with the chemical formula (C14H21NO11)n. This compound is categorized under theglycosaminoglycancompounds. However, hyaluronic acid is unique because it is the only non-sulfated glycosaminoglycan among them. This compound naturally occurs in the human body. It can undergo distribution throughout connective, epithelial, and neural tissues.

What is Niacinamide?
Niacinamide or nicotinamide is an organic compound having the chemical formula C6H6N2O. It is a form of vitamin B3. This vitamin can be found in some foods (such as meat, fish, nuts, mushrooms, etc.), and it is also available commercially as a dietary supplement. This dietary supplement is important in treating and preventing pellagra. Moreover, this substance has the ability of skin flushing, and it is used to treat acne on the skin.

Figure 02: The Chemical Structure of Niacinamide
As a medication, niacinamide has minimum side effects, which include liver problems at high doses. Moreover, the normal doses are safe to be taken during pregnancy.

The medical uses of niacinamide include the treatment of niacin deficiency, treating acne on the skin, decreasing the risk of skin cancers, etc.

Hyaluronic acid and niacinamide are very important ingredients in many skincare products because these compounds can keep the brightness and healthy look in our skin. The key difference between hyaluronic acid and niacinamide is that hyaluronic acid is helpful in moisturizing the skin, whereas niacinamide is helpful in treating acne in the skin. Moreover, hyaluronic acid is a sugar compound, whereas niacinamide is a vitamin.
